Main duties of the job
The purpose of this role is to:
Provide a safe, high quality and accessible phlebotomy service to the practice population.Perform venipunctures and capillary punctures to obtain blood samples from patients.Properly label, store, and prepare specimens for laboratory testing and transportation.Verify patient identification and medical records before performing procedures.Educate patients on the blood draw process and answer any questions.Maintain accurate records of patient interactions and specimen collections.Follow infection control and safety protocols to ensure a sterile environment.Manage supplies and restock phlebotomy equipment as needed.Assist with clerical duties, such as scheduling appointments and updating patient records.
About us
Banbury Cross Health Centre was launched in September 2019, following the merger of West Bar Surgery, Banbury Health Centre and Horsefair Surgery. Banbury Cross Health Centre is managed by Principal Medical Limited (PML), a not-for-profit organisation.
We have two locations in Banbury town centre, at South Bar House and Bridge Street.
Banbury Cross Health Centre offers care and support from GPs, Nurses, Advance Health Practitioners, Allied Health Practitioners, Healthcare Assistants and Pharmacists. Supported by operational administrative teams to ensure efficiency within our care and treatment towards you our patients.
We are proud to be a training practice, helping qualified doctors, known as Registrars, complete the final stages of their GP training.
The practice is also unique in Oxfordshire in being its own Primary Care Network.
